Weekly Webinar Series Part 6: Managing Lung Cancer Patients Through the COVID-19 Pandemic
Advertisement
Episodes in this series

In part 6 of our weekly COVID-19 Webinar Series, Nathan Pennell, MD, PhD; Stephen Liu, MD; Charu Aggarwal, MD, MPH; H. Jack West, MD; and special guest speaker, Brendon Stiles, MD; share the latest updates and insights on the novel coronavirus.
The faculty shares outside perspectives on:
- Lung cancer surgery in the era of COVID-19
- Highlights from lung cancer data presented at the AACR Virtual Annual Meeting
- Directions and conclusions for the future of lung cancer care
